Topics Covered

  1. 1. Introduction to Image Segmentation: Learners will understand the basics of image segmentation, including its importance in various applications. They will gain foundational knowledge on how to approach image segmentation problems and the common terminologies used in the field.
  2. 2. Overview of U-Net Architecture: This module introduces the U-Net architecture and its design principles. Learners will study the key components of U-Net and how it excels in biomedical image segmentation tasks, preparing them for more in-depth study.
  3. 3. Preprocessing Techniques for Image Segmentation: Learners will explore various preprocessing techniques essential for preparing images before applying U-Net. This includes scaling, normalization, and augmentation, enabling them to improve the quality and efficiency of their segmentation models.
  4. 4. Data Labeling and Preparation: This module covers the process of labeling images and preparing data for training U-Net models. Learners will learn how to use popular tools and techniques for accurate and efficient data labeling.
  5. 5. Implementing U-Net from Scratch: Learners will gain hands-on experience in coding U-Net from scratch using a programming language like Python. This module focuses on understanding and implementing the core architecture and mechanisms of U-Net.
  6. 6. Advanced U-Net Variants and Improvements: This module delves into advanced variations of U-Net, such asNested U-Net and Attention U-Net, and explores ways to enhance the original architecture for better segmentation performance.
  7. 7. Training and Tuning U-Net Models: Learners will learn how to train U-Net models effectively and fine-tune them for optimal performance. This includes understanding loss functions, metrics, and optimization techniques specific to image segmentation.
  8. 8. Evaluation and Validation of Segmentation Models: This module teaches learners how to evaluate and validate their U-Net models using appropriate metrics and techniques. They will learn to assess model performance and make necessary adjustments.
  9. 9. Real-World Applications of U-Net: Learners will explore real-world applications of U-Net in different industries, such as medical imaging, autonomous driving, and remote sensing. This module provides insights into practical use cases and industry-specific challenges.
  10. 10. Deployment and Integration of Segmentation Models: The final module focuses on deploying and integrating U-Net models into real-world applications. Learners will learn about deployment strategies, integration with existing systems, and the considerations involved in operations and maintenance.
